What Are Freestyle Type Beats?

To be conscious of the value of freestyle trap beats, it's essential to initially break down what a freestyle beat really is. In easy terms, a freestyle beat is an instrumental track that is made for musicians to rap or sing over without the demand for pre-written lyrics or tunes. It's meant to motivate off-the-cuff efficiencies, urging rappers to provide spontaneous and often a lot more raw, emotional verses.

A freestyle type beat differs slightly from a routine instrumental in that it's structured in such a way that gives artists space to breathe. These beats frequently have fewer melodious aspects, leaving area for complex circulations and effective wordplay. They're at the same time generally a lot more repeated than conventional tune instrumentals, guaranteeing that the rap artist or vocalist can easily discover their groove and ride the beat without obtaining shed in complex plans.

Freestyle Trap Beats A Subgenre Within Freestyle

Currently, within the world of freestyle beats, there is a certain part called freestyle trap beat. Trap music, originating from the southern United States, is defined by bulky use of 808 bass drums, quick hi-hat patterns, and dark, moody melodies. It's a audio that has expanded in appeal over the years, becoming one of the most influential genres in modern rap.

Freestyle trap beats take these signature facets and fuse them with the liberty and adaptability of freestyle beats, causing a strong blending. These beats are best for musicians wanting to bring energy and aggressiveness to their knowledgeables while still preserving the flexibility to explore various circulations and styles.

DaBaby Type Beat: A Modern Freestyle Idol

Among the many variations of freestyle catch beats, the DaBaby type beat has turned into one of one of the most popular. DaBaby type beats are inspired by the trademark sound of the North Carolina rap artist DaBaby, known for his speedy shipment, catchy hooks, and compelling production. These beats typically include fast paces, punchy 808s, and minimalistic yet aggressive melodies, making them excellent for high-energy freestyle performances.

Why DaBaby Type Beats Work So perfect for Freestyles

1. Fast Paces: The quick pace of a DaBaby type beat motivates rap artists to provide speedy flows, forcing them to believe on their feet and press their lyrical limits.
2. Straightforward Yet Appealing Tunes: Unlike some trap beats that can be overly complicated, DaBaby type beats are often developed around straightforward, repetitive melodies that leave area for the rapper's vocals to radiate.
3. Potent Drums: The aggressive percussion in these beats adds an aspect of necessity, driving the musician to match the beat's intensity with their lyrics.

What Is a Free Type Beat?

A free type beat is an instrumental that music producers give totally free use, usually for non-commercial purposes. While the beats can be used for trials, freestyles, and social networks content, musicians normally need to buy a certificate if they wish to release the track commercially (i.e., on streaming systems or to buy).

This model has actually been a game-changer, allowing young musicians to try out their sound, exercise their freestyling, and build an online existence without needing to fret about manufacturing expenses.
